Karma: 2018 Mercedes-Benz Sprinter Conversion
Karma is our 2018 Mercedes-Benz Sprinter conversion — a classic Sprinter build that set the tone for everything we've built since. At 19 feet long, she seats and sleeps 2, making her ideal for couples or solo travelers who want the full Mercedes Sprinter experience with the reliability and road presence that the Sprinter platform is known for.
The Sprinter chassis gives Karma a taller interior than the ProMaster vans — you can stand up fully inside, which makes a real difference after a long day on the Road to Hana. Like all our vans, Karma comes with a gas range stovetop, farm sink with hot water, hot water shower, refrigerator/freezer, solar panels, full or queen-sized bed, and everything you need to camp in comfort across Maui.
Best for: Couples or solo travelers who want a classic Sprinter build with a spacious, stand-up interior.

Bali: 2021 Dodge ProMaster Conversion
Bali is our 2021 Dodge ProMaster conversion and the only van in our fleet that seats 4 and sleeps 3 — making her the clear choice for small families or groups of three traveling together. At 19 feet long with upgraded interior features, Bali brings the same full equipment package as our other vans with the added capacity to accommodate more travelers.
If you're planning a family adventure to Hosmer Grove or a trip around Maui with a third traveler in the mix, Bali is the van that makes it work without anyone feeling cramped. The 2021 model year also brings interior upgrades over the earlier ProMaster builds.
Best for: Small families, groups of three, or anyone who needs to seat and sleep more than two people.

How to Decide: A Quick Guide by Traveler Type
- Couple seeking a classic Sprinter experience: Karma
- Couple wanting maximum interior space and storage: Nalu
- Family or group of three: Bali — the only van that seats and sleeps 3
- Couple wanting the newest, most premium build: Lotus
All four vans include the same full equipment list — gas range stovetop, farm sink with hot water, hot water shower, refrigerator/freezer, solar panels, dimmable lighting, outlets, odorless toilet, top-quality linens, full or queen-sized bed, swivel seats up front, and two ventilation fans. The differences come down to platform, capacity, model year, and interior refinements.
